A thoroughly deserved three points based on the balance of the game today.
With guys like Gallagher, Wright, Levis, Uche and White in our team, we should be a big threat from set pieces if we can put good crosses into the box.
The quality and consistency of the deliveries from Henderson and Mackie were outstanding - They caused Rovers problems on every occasion.
Uche and White took their goals really well and their all round game was excellent - Give them both quality, consistent service and they’ll find the back of the net more often than not.
Our back three managed the game really well and were very good both in and out of possession - I hope Gallagher’s injury isn’t anything serious as I thought he was outstanding both last week at Ayr and today as well.
In my opinion, there’s a few County “fans” who simply aren’t willing to give Ketts a chance - They couldn’t wait to get their knives out for him after the defeats against Morton and Queens Park, and no doubt they’ll do the same again if/when we have other bumps on the road.
I think it’s worth mentioning that it took nineteen league matches under Cowie, Docherty and across Robertson’s two interim spells to pick up thirteen points.
In contrast, Ketts has come in and picked up the same amount of points in only seven league matches.
Cowie/Docherty/Robertson
Played - 19
Won - 2
Draw - 7
Lost - 10
Goals Scored - 18
Goals Conceded - 36
Points - 13
Points Per Game - 0.68
Kettlewell
Played - 7
Won - 4
Draw - 1
Lost - 2
Goals Scored - 7
Goals Conceded - 3
Points - 13
Points Per Game - 1.86
There’s absolutely no doubt that we’ve had a big upturn in form since Ketts’ return - He’s getting the best out of the players at the moment and he’s implemented a defensive structure that’s stopped us conceding goals for fun.
Are there still areas to improve? Of course, I’d like to see us a bit more dangerous/creative in open play but hopefully that’ll come as confidence grows in the squad.
Here’s hoping we can carry the momentum from today’s performance/result into a tough game on Tuesday night at East End Park.
